Transaction 96072426af068b7680ea5053493b28a3a36c2e74b69edb5a7737c77571bc47d4

36 Input
2 Outputs
  • 96072426af068b7680ea5053493b28a3a36c2e74b69edb5a7737c77571bc47d4:0
  • value  7246
    address  14bcRPbhFq4KGuaJRXFS1AQsPUEoYxa8C1
  • 96072426af068b7680ea5053493b28a3a36c2e74b69edb5a7737c77571bc47d4:1
  • value  41640000
    address  3BGVi3r7cy9SRg1aiGpa3snQq4MnmpJS3T